electrum

Electrum Bitcoin wallet
git clone https://git.parazyd.org/electrum
Log | Files | Refs | Submodules

commit f2f01a0b9d0d8a4db414cfeb74249a57ad0e31c6
parent c92875a6d5be4489a26a54b61ca3fcc11b6d6f04
Author: ThomasV <thomasv@gitorious>
Date:   Mon, 14 Nov 2011 00:20:49 +0100

patch for windows

Diffstat:
Mclient/gui.py | 13+++++++++++--
1 file changed, 11 insertions(+), 2 deletions(-)

diff --git a/client/gui.py b/client/gui.py @@ -718,11 +718,20 @@ class BitcoinGUI: button = gtk.Button("Copy to clipboard") def copy2clipboard(w, treeview, liststore): + import platform path, col = treeview.get_cursor() if path: address = liststore.get_value( liststore.get_iter(path), 0) - c = gtk.clipboard_get() - c.set_text( address ) + if platform.system() == 'Windows': + from Tkinter import Tk + r = Tk() + r.withdraw() + r.clipboard_clear() + r.clipboard_append( address ) + r.destroy() + else: + c = gtk.clipboard_get() + c.set_text( address ) button.connect("clicked", copy2clipboard, treeview, liststore) button.show() hbox.pack_start(button,False)